Description
The University Archives Vertical Files collection contains subject files organized alphabetically by topic or department.
Materials within include fliers, brochures, posters, publications, informational packets, reports, and biographical information
on the University of California, Irvine's people, departments, founding, and general history.
Background
The University Archives collect and preserve records of UCI's history. The archives' collections cover topics including "the
planning and growth of the campus, the development and administration of academic and administrative programs and services,
faculty concerns, student life and community relations."
The Vertical Files are composed of a variety of materials which were gradually collected and sorted by the University Archives.
